About MSG Entertainment

MSG Entertainment (MSGE), the live entertainment arm of Cablevision Systems Corporations, is a worldwide entertainment company recognized for its signature combination of event production and entertainment marketing. MSGE manages and operates all facets of the booking, marketing and production of all events at Radio City Music Hall and the Beacon Theatre, as well as the entertainment events at Madison Square Garden, The WaMu Theater at Madison Square Garden, the Expo Center at MSG, and The Chicago Theatre.

In addition to the nearly 700 entertainment concerts and events that take place each year at these venues, MSGE produces shows across America. MSG Entertainment's live events include The Radio City Christmas Spectacular, as well as six productions of The Christmas Spectacular outside of New York.

Concerts & Attractions

MSG Entertainment presents many of today's top performing artists at the famed Radio City Music Hall, Madison Square Garden, The WaMu Theatre at Madison Square Garden, the Beacon Theatre, and The Chicago Theatre. MSG served as host to numerous sold-out shows by leading acts such as U2, Madonna, Billy Joel, Elton John, Coldplay, Andrea Bocelli, and Bruce Springsteen. Radio City has hosted renowned artists including Tony Bennett, Phish, Alicia Keys, Usher, Bette Midler, Neil Young, Don Henley, Mary J. Blige, Enrique Iglesias, Beck and Josh Groban among others. Family theatrical productions have included Annie, Peter Pan, Sesame Street Live, Dora the Explorer, Blues Clues, The Wiggles and more.

Special Events

The Legendary venues have played host to some of the most prestigious award shows in the country, including the Grammy Awards, MTV VMAs, Tony Awards, Daytime Emmy Awards, VH1 Vogue Fashion Awards, as well as the 39th Annual Country Music Awards, which marked the first and only time the show has appeared outside of Nashville. Three very important benefit concerts have also marked the history of both Madison Square Garden and Radio City Music Hall, including "From the Big Apple to the Big Easy" in 2005 in response to Hurricane Katrina; "The Concert For New York City" to celebrate the strength, resilience and pride of New York City and America in the wake of the September 11 tragedy; and George Harrison's 1971 Concert for Bangladesh, arguably the first major benefit live concert event of its kind.
